如何将云主机数据库导出

如何将云主机数据库导出

如何将云主机数据库导出

将云主机数据库导出的主要步骤包括:选择合适的工具、配置导出参数、执行导出操作、验证导出结果。选择合适的工具是关键,因为不同的数据库类型和云服务提供商会有不同的工具和方法,本文将详细介绍MySQL数据库的导出操作。

一、选择合适的工具

在导出云主机数据库时,选择合适的工具是至关重要的。常见的工具包括命令行工具(如mysqldump)、图形化管理工具(如phpMyAdmin、HeidiSQL)以及云服务提供商提供的专用工具(如AWS RDS的导出功能)。

1. 命令行工具

命令行工具如mysqldump是导出MySQL数据库的常用方法。mysqldump工具不仅可以导出数据库,还可以实现数据备份和迁移。使用它需要一定的命令行操作基础。

2. 图形化管理工具

图形化管理工具如phpMyAdmin和HeidiSQL提供了更直观的界面,适合不熟悉命令行操作的用户。这些工具通常提供导出向导,使导出过程更加简单和直观。

3. 云服务提供商的专用工具

云服务提供商如AWS、Azure和Google Cloud提供了专用的数据库管理工具,这些工具通常集成在云服务的管理界面中,提供自动化的导出功能和更多的选项。

二、配置导出参数

在导出数据库之前,需要配置相关的导出参数,包括选择导出格式、指定导出的数据库和表、设置导出选项等。

1. 选择导出格式

常见的导出格式包括SQL文件、CSV文件等。SQL文件包含了数据库的结构和数据,可以方便地导入到其他数据库中。CSV文件则适用于数据分析和处理。

2. 指定导出的数据库和表

在配置导出参数时,需要明确指定要导出的数据库和表。如果只需要导出部分表,可以在导出工具中进行选择。

3. 设置导出选项

导出选项包括是否包含数据库结构、是否包含数据、是否压缩导出文件等。根据实际需求进行配置,可以提高导出的效率和可用性。

三、执行导出操作

配置好导出参数后,就可以执行导出操作了。不同的工具有不同的操作方法,以下分别介绍mysqldump、phpMyAdmin和AWS RDS的导出操作。

1. 使用mysqldump命令行工具

在命令行中执行以下命令,可以将数据库导出为SQL文件:

mysqldump -u 用户名 -p 数据库名 > 导出文件.sql

其中,-u参数指定用户名,-p参数指定密码,数据库名为要导出的数据库名称,导出文件.sql为导出文件的名称。

2. 使用phpMyAdmin图形化工具

在phpMyAdmin中,选择要导出的数据库,点击“导出”选项卡,选择导出格式和选项,然后点击“执行”按钮即可完成导出。

3. 使用AWS RDS专用工具

在AWS管理控制台中,选择要导出的RDS实例,点击“导出”选项,配置导出参数,然后点击“开始导出”按钮即可完成导出。

四、验证导出结果

导出完成后,需要对导出的文件进行验证,以确保导出结果的完整性和准确性。

1. 检查文件大小和内容

首先检查导出文件的大小,确保文件大小与预期一致。然后打开导出文件,检查文件内容是否包含了所有的数据库结构和数据。

2. 导入测试

将导出文件导入到新的数据库实例中,检查导入过程是否顺利,以及导入后的数据库是否完整。如果出现错误,需要根据错误信息进行修正。

五、注意事项

在导出云主机数据库时,还需要注意一些事项,以确保导出过程的顺利进行。

1. 数据库锁定

在导出过程中,数据库可能会被锁定,导致其他操作无法进行。为避免影响业务运行,可以选择在业务低峰期进行导出操作。

2. 数据安全

导出文件中可能包含敏感数据,需要妥善保管导出文件,避免泄露。在传输导出文件时,可以选择加密传输。

3. 导出速度

导出大规模数据库时,导出速度可能会较慢。可以通过选择合适的导出选项和优化数据库性能来提高导出速度。

六、导出过程中的常见问题及解决方法

在导出云主机数据库的过程中,可能会遇到一些常见问题,以下列举并介绍解决方法。

1. 导出文件过大

导出文件过大可能导致传输和存储困难。可以通过分割导出、压缩导出文件等方法来解决。

2. 导出过程中断

导出过程中断可能由网络问题、数据库锁定等原因引起。可以选择稳定的网络环境,并在业务低峰期进行导出操作。

3. 导出文件格式不兼容

不同数据库和工具可能使用不同的导出格式,导出文件格式不兼容可能导致导入失败。可以选择通用的导出格式,如SQL文件,或者使用转换工具进行格式转换。

七、导出工具推荐

在导出云主机数据库时,可以选择合适的工具来提高效率和方便性。以下推荐两款工具:

1. 研发项目管理系统PingCode

PingCode是一款强大的研发项目管理系统,支持数据库导出功能,提供自动化的导出流程和丰富的导出选项,适合大型项目的数据库管理。

2. 通用项目协作软件Worktile

Worktile是一款通用项目协作软件,支持数据库导出和导入功能,提供直观的操作界面和便捷的导出向导,适合中小型项目的数据库管理。

八、总结

将云主机数据库导出是数据库管理中的重要环节,选择合适的工具、配置正确的导出参数、执行导出操作并验证导出结果是保证导出顺利进行的关键。通过本文的介绍,相信您已经掌握了将云主机数据库导出的基本方法和注意事项,可以根据实际需求选择合适的导出工具和方法,提高数据库管理的效率和安全性。

相关问答FAQs:

1. 如何将云主机数据库导出?

  • 问题:我想将云主机上的数据库导出,该怎么做?
  • 回答:您可以使用数据库管理工具,如phpMyAdmin或MySQL Workbench,连接到云主机上的数据库,并选择导出选项,然后按照指示导出数据库。

2. 如何将云主机上的特定表格导出为CSV文件?

  • 问题:我想将云主机上的特定表格导出为CSV文件,应该怎么做?
  • 回答:您可以使用数据库管理工具,如phpMyAdmin或MySQL Workbench,连接到云主机上的数据库,并选择要导出的表格。然后,选择导出为CSV文件的选项,并按照指示导出所选表格。

3. 如何将云主机数据库备份到本地计算机?

  • 问题:我想将云主机上的数据库备份到我的本地计算机,有什么方法可以实现?
  • 回答:您可以使用数据库管理工具,如phpMyAdmin或MySQL Workbench,连接到云主机上的数据库,并选择数据库备份选项。然后,选择将备份文件保存到本地计算机的选项,并按照指示完成备份过程。这样,您就可以将云主机数据库备份保存到本地计算机上了。

原创文章,作者:Edit1,如若转载,请注明出处:https://docs.pingcode.com/baike/1938851

(0)
Edit1Edit1
上一篇 3天前
下一篇 3天前
免费注册
电话联系

4008001024

微信咨询
微信咨询
返回顶部